December 28, 1955 <br />s <br />A special meeting of the Board of Public Works was held at 10:00 A. M. Wednesday, <br />�Deeember 28, 1955. All members were present. <br />The Board first considere4 the request of Ben Medow, Inc. for permission to use a <br />;mobile searchlight for the evenings of Wednesday and Thursday, December 28th and 29th <br />;respectively; the equipment to occupy the necessary space upon the sidewalk next to the <br />(curb. Permission was so granted. <br />Contractorts Bond in the sum of $1,000.00, for Wm. H. Burke & Robert H. Burke, was <br />examined and approved. <br />There being no other business to come before,the Board at this time, the meeting was <br />adjourned at 10:10 A. M. <br />JANUARY 3, 1956 <br />A regular meeting of the Board of Public Works was held on Tuesday, January 3, <br />1956 at 10:00 A.M. All members were present. <br />R. S.
